About Tomoo Fujisawa

Tomoo Fujisawa is a scholar working on Hepatology, Epidemiology and Gastroenterology, having authored 158 papers that have together received 2.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(56 papers), Hepatitis B Virus Studies (51 papers), Hepatitis C virus research (47 papers), Liver Diseases and Immunity (20 papers), Pediatric Hepatobiliary Diseases and Treatments (14 papers), Hepatitis Viruses Studies and Epidemiology (13 papers), Trace Elements in Health (10 papers) and Liver Disease and Transplantation (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Hepatology (1.0k citations), Epidemiology (1.1k citations) and Gastroenterology (113 citations). Tomoo Fujisawa has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Ayano Inui, Haruki Komatsu, Tsuyoshi Sogo, Tomoyuki Tsunoda, Isao Sekine, Déirdre Kelly, Solange Heller, Paloma Jara, Neelam Mohan and Uzma Shah.
